Senior Trader - Long End US Treasury Futures & Cash Bonds

-->
Apply for Job Here

Description

About DRW Trading Group

DRW Trading Group is a proprietary trading organization. Using internally developed methods, models and technology, we trade across a wide range of asset classes both domestically and internationally. All of our trading activity is for our own account, and all of our methods and systems are developed solely for our use. Unlike hedge funds, brokerage firms and banks, DRW has no customers, clients or investors.

Founded in 1992, our mission is to empower a team of exceptional individuals to identify and capture trading opportunities in the global markets by leveraging and integrating technology, risk management and quantitative research. With that spirit, DRW has embraced the integration of trading and technology and has devoted extensive time, capital and resources to develop fast, precise and reliable infrastructure and applications. Our technology, along with our commitment and creativity, has greatly enhanced our ability to improve and expand our operations, solve complex problems and capture new opportunities.

DRW is headquartered in Chicago and has offices in New York City and London and employs over 450 people worldwide from many different disciplines and backgrounds.

DRW is currently seeking a Senior Treasury Trader to oversee/undertake daily trading in both futures and cash in long end US treasuries.

Responsibilities

* Identify and capture current opportunities; research and introduce new trading strategies for the long end of the curve

* Communicate daily with the rest of the fixed income team regarding new opportunities and strategies

* Engage in daily trading of on the run cash and futures contracts in the long end of the curve

* Trade long end off the run treasuries

* Carefully manage the curve and delta risk of a long end portfolio

* Assist in the growth and development of junior traders

Requirements

* Minimum of three years experience successfully managing a US Treasury cash and futures flow book

* Previous experience trading a long end treasury book highly preferred

* Must have strong risk management skills and an in-depth understanding of the functioning of the treasury and repo markets

* Bachelor's degree

* Must be proficient in Excel and Bloomberg

* Excellent interpersonal and communication skills

* Strong quantitative skills

* Strong team player

* Demonstrate a flexible working manner

* Strong problem-solving skills essential

* Proven ability to develop creative solutions

* Proven ability to investigate issues within own area of work and pursue goals and objectives until achieved

Senior Trader - Level 2

-->
Apply for Job

Description

09-0069 Senior Trader - Level 2

Pepco Holdings, Inc. (PHI) is one of the largest electricity delivery and natural gas companies in the mid-Atlantic region. More than 1.8 million customers in Washington D.C., Delaware, Maryland, New Jersey and Virginia depend on PHI for their electricity and natural gas needs.

We are seeking a Senior Trader to join the staff at our Newark, Delaware location. Senior Trader - Level 2 utilize short-term power trading experience in the evaluation and execution of hourly electricity transactions in the Day Ahead and Real Time markets of the eastern interconnect power grid within the current and prompt months. Demonstrate a high level of trading and fundamental expertise in at least one of the following pools: PJM, MISO, NYISO, ISO-NE, and IESO. Perform detailed fundamental and statistical analysis to optimize trading opportunities. Coordinate with other business units on the trading floor to optimize financial opportunities for the Short-term Power Trading desk as well as the overall company. Maintain trading practices within the Merchant Risk Management guidelines and corporate ethical standards. Conectiv currently operates a 4-day, 40 hour per week rotating schedule with no overnight shift.

Requirements

* Bachelor's degree in Accounting, Business, Marketing, Finance or Engineering OR the equivalent combination of education, training, and/or experience.
* Experience demonstrating skill evaluating and executing short-term power trading (physical and/or financial hourly and/or daily electricity transactions).
* Experience demonstrating skill performing detailed fundamental and statistical analyses (e.g., analyzing LMP, congestion, unit availability).
* Experience demonstrating skill initiating and developing new, creative, and/or innovative trading strategies, opportunities, and/or analysis techniques to optimize power trading transactions.
* Experience demonstrating skill maintaining a power-trading system, to include entering all transactions, submitting schedules and verifying transactions with counterparties.
* Experience demonstrating skill providing daily market intelligence information (e.g., identifying buyers and sellers at various hub locations, recording market prices being transacted, and/or identifying transmission outages/constraints and presenting data to others..
* Experience demonstrating skill developing credible and effective relationships with internal and external parties (e.g., other business units, trading/scheduling counterparties).
* Experience demonstrating skill using OASIS and ISO trading systems to accurately execute and maintain transactions on a timely basis and optimize with NERC operation guidelines and procedures.
* Experience demonstrating advanced skill using PC-based word processing, spreadsheet, Internet and e-mail software (e.g., to create communications, perform statistical/fundamental analysis, visit operational interfaces).
* Ability and willingness to analyze and adapt to multiple and changing market conditions to take advantage of market volatility (for example, monitor computer applications simultaneously, adapt to new rules regarding market activity).
* Ability and willingness to function quickly and accurately in a time constrained environment.
* Ability and willingness to work in a team environment with group performance based rewards.
* Ability and willingness to work varying and rotating shifts (24 hours a day, 7 days a week, 365 days a year), be flexible to schedule changes and work extended hours as required.
* Must successfully pass Criminal History Records Check.

Preferred:

* Detailed knowledge of MISO and/or NYISO transmission and generation grids.
* Experience in FTR analysis and trading in MISO, NYISO, and/or NE-ISO.

Senior Prop Trader: $100-130K

-->
Apply for Job

Description

SENIOR PROPRIETARY TRADER (5304)

Responsibilities:

Responsible for trading energy commodities, options, heat rates, and energy products in various markets (MISO, PJM, NYISO) ranging from intraday through 5 years, depending on assigned book. Perform individual research, deal entry management, and monthly reconciliation. Make markets for asset optimization groups that are responsible for hedging company's nationwide generation portfolio.

Qualifications:

Bachelor???s Degree in Business or Technical field. Post graduate education a plus. Three years of relevant experience required with career progression to include physical scheduling and hourly, cash, and financial trading (dependent on assigned book). High level of math background preferred. Knowledge of multiple trading transaction systems helpful. Must be a disciplined trader, highly organized, and a team player willing to work with individuals across all parts of a diversified regulated/competitive energy corporation. Must be able to bring a track record of profitable trading while abiding by and managing positions within VaR, P&L variance, and stop loss limits commensurate with the authorized position size

Salary:

$100,000 - $130,000 (plus bonus - percentage of book)

Senior Trader, TN

-->
Apply for Job:

Description
Job Function: Supply Chain/Logistics

Business Unit: Global Primary Products

Job Status: Full-Time

Relocation Eligible: Yes

Position Description: At Alcoa, our goal is to be the best company in the world! Alcoa is the world's leading producer and manager of primary aluminum, fabricated aluminum and alumina facilities, and is active in all major aspects of the industry. Alcoa serves the aerospace, automotive, packaging, building and construction, commercial transportation, and industrial markets, bringing design, engineering, production, and other capabilities of Alcoa’s businesses as a single solution to customers.

The Senior Trader will be located at our downtown office in Knoxville, TN. The Trader has accountability to provide term power trading, origination, and environmental attribute trading functions for Alcoa Power Generating Inc., Alcoa Power Marketing LLC, and Alcoa Allowance Management Inc. on behalf of Alcoa, Inc. The position performs term physical power transactions, emission allowance trading including but not limited to SO2, NOx, CO2e, RECS, white credits, and Hg, financial trading to hedge Alcoa power positions, and custom deal origination including CO2e offsets. This position will require some domestic and international travel and this opportunity could be a job grade 19 or 20 depending on experience.

MAJOR RESPONSIBILITIES:

* Perform long term physical power transactions (1 mo. or greater), environmental attribute trading, financial trades in support of power positions as approved by the SRMC, and remarket of long term transmission positions
* Pursue Origination deals. These are longer term, custom power deals that may involve capacity, ancillary services, transmission access, operating and trading services, and/or leasing and require the development of a stand alone contract/agreement
* Pursue CO2e world-wide offset opportunities
* Transact CO2e in any of the worldwide market in support of Alcoa Inc. facility and corporate needs
* Transact in compliance and voluntary RECS and efficiency credits (white) markets
* Oversee any market positions and compliance obligations that Alcoa Inc. chooses to have on various power or environmental trading exchanges such as CCX or ICE
* Perform special assignments and projects as assigned by the Director, Energy Markets
